?xml version="1.0" encoding="UTF-8"?persistence xmlns="http://java.sun.com/xml/ns/persistence" version="2.0" !--配置persistence-unit节点 持久化单元 name:持久化单元名称 transection-type:事务管理方式 JTA:分布式事务管
<?xml version="1.0" encoding="UTF-8"?> <persistence xmlns="http://java.sun.com/xml/ns/persistence" version="2.0"> <!--配置persistence-unit节点 持久化单元 name:持久化单元名称 transection-type:事务管理方式 JTA:分布式事务管理(多个数据库) RESOURCE_LOCAL 本地事务管理(一个数据库)--> <persistence-unit name="myjpa" transaction-type="RESOURCE_LOCAL"> <!--jpA实现方式HibernatePersistenceProvider--> <provider>org.hibernate.jpa.HibernatePersistenceProvider</provider> <!--数据库信息--> <properties> <property name="javax.persistence.jdbc.user" value="root"/> <property name="javax.persistence.jdbc.password" value="root"/> <property name="javax.persistence.jdbc.driver" value="com.mysql.jdbc.Driver"/> <property name="javax.persistence.jdbc.url" value="jdbc:mysql:///ww9501"/> <!--可选配置:配置jpa实现方式的配置 显示SQL 自动创建数据库表: create创建数据表如果有表先删后建 update 创建表如果有表不创建表 none 不创建表--> <property name="hibernate.show_sql" value="true"/> <property name="hibernate.hb,2ddl.auto" value="create"/> </properties> </persistence-unit> </persistence>